179/**
180 * Convert a samplerate (in Hz) to the 'divcount' value the LA8 wants.
181 *
182 * LA8 hardware: sample period = (divcount + 1) * 10ns.
183 * Min. value for divcount: 0x00 (10ns sample period, 100MHz samplerate).
184 * Max. value for divcount: 0xfe (2550ns sample period, 392.15kHz samplerate).
185 *
186 * @param samplerate The samplerate in Hz.
187 * @return The divcount value as needed by the hardware, or 0xff upon errors.
188 */
189static uint8_t samplerate_to_divcount(uint64_t samplerate)
190{
191 if (samplerate == 0) {
30939770 192 sr_err("la8: %s: samplerate was 0", __func__);
f4314d7e
UH
193 return 0xff;
194 }
195
196 if (!is_valid_samplerate(samplerate)) {
30939770
UH
197 sr_err("la8: %s: can't get divcount, samplerate invalid",
198 __func__);
f4314d7e
UH
199 return 0xff;
200 }
201
202 return (SR_MHZ(100) / samplerate) - 1;
203}
